Chang-Yang Lee is an outside director at LG Display. Chang-Yang was previously a staff engineer at Seagate Technology from July 2013 to January 2017, working in tribology and MEMS. Before that, they were a post-doc and full-time engineer at the National Institute of Standards and Technology from February 2003 to June 2013, working in tribology and MEMS. Chang-Yang also worked as a student researcher and engineer at the Korea Institute of Science and Technology from September 1996 to January 2003, working in tribology. From January 1992 to December 1998, they worked as an engineer at Samsung in materials engineering, surface engineering, and tribology.

Chang Yang-Lee completed their PhD in Mechanical Engineering at Yonsei University. Chang-Yang also holds a Master of Science in Mechanical Engineering from Yonsei University, as well as a Bachelor of Science in Materials Science from the same institution. In addition, they have a certification from Seagate Technology in Six Sigma Certified Brown Belt.
